One Piece: The Three Stages of Imu’s Abyss-Themed Devil Contracts, Explained

For a long time, One Piece fans believed there were only two main power systems in One Piece, which are Haki and the Devil Fruits. However, author Oda has been redefining the powers of the One Piece world since the introduction of the Five Elders. In the ongoing Elbaf arc, a new power system has been specially made for the important members of the World Government, and it is tied to their creator, Imu. The recent chapters have slowly started to reveal the different tiers of contract one can get into by receiving the Abyss Mark, and we have discussed them in detail here.

What Are Imu’s Devil Contracts in One Piece?

Making a deal with the devil is no longer a common phrase in One Piece, as the latest One Piece Chapter 1167 revealed the three stages of demonic power that Imu shares with her servants through the Abyss Mark. It’s not the Marines, but instead the higher officials of the World Government, including the Five Elders and the God Knights, who currently wield the devilish powers in the One Piece story.

All one needs to do to gain access to Imu’s powers is to receive the Abyss Mark on their arm and enter into a contract with the god. As the Five Elders stated, three different stages of devil contracts can be made, namely: The Shallows Covenant, The Depths Covenant, and The Abyssal Covenant. As you can see here, the titles of the contracts appear to have been inspired by the depths of the sea, which is another significant hint that Imu is the Sea Devil in One Piece.

Three Different Stages of Covenant in One Piece

Each stage of the contract or covenant made with the god, Imu, has its own perks and powers. So, let’s look into each tier based on everything we know about them so far:

The Shallows Covenant

The Shallows Covenant seems to be the contract made by the lowest-tier members of the God’s Knight, ‘A Devoted Blade of God.’ Gunko started as a God’s Blade during the God Valley incident. Now, King Harald became ‘A Devoted Blade of God’ along with Shanks by accepting the Shallows Covenant. Interestingly, the devoted blades, Harald and Shanks, had an Abyss Mark on their arms that resembled the symbol of the World Government.

The Shallows Covenant is a mere trace of a bond…

Since it is more of a beginner’s contract, the access to Imu’s powers is minimal. Those who accepted the Shallows Covenant don’t directly come under the control of Imu, and they can only use the Abyss mark to travel between locations through the Abyss.

The Depths Covenant

The next tier of agreement is called the Depths Covenant, and it is described as an exclusive contract for only thirteen individuals in the story. Since the Shallows Covenant is reserved for the entry-level Blade of Gods, the Depths Covenant is the agreement made between the full-fledged God’s Knight members and Imu.

Thou art an Undying Knight in service to Imu…

Those who entered the Depths devil contract with Imu seem to possess an upgraded version of the Abyss mark tattoo, where a curved horn is added to the World Government symbol. When King Harald was anointed as a Holy Knight, the powers that come with the Depths Covenant were revealed. In addition to gaining travel access, the knights become immortal with the ability to regenerate, and their respective strength is significantly enhanced.

But there is a catch with these power upgrades. In exchange for inheriting these powers, those who have accepted the Depths Covenant lose control of their body to Imu. Even if they don’t wish to do something, they must obey Imu’s orders at all costs.

The Abyssal Covenant

The final level of Imu’s contract is called the Abyssal Covenant. It’s also similar to the Depths Covenant, as it’s an exclusive covenant between Imu and the 13 characters. However, the variety of powers bestowed must be the highest here, as it is the deepest level of the covenant with the god Imu. So, basically, all the powers shared by Imu can be accessed by characters with the Abyssal contract.

It is highly likely that the Gorosei (Five Elders) and the important members of the God’s Knight received the Abyssal contract. Because they are directly below Imu, and their god can take control of their body as they desire. For example, Imu has currently taken over Gunko’s body in Elbaf and took control of St. Saturn’s body during the God Valley incident.

In addition, those who have accepted the Abyssal Covenant are expected to inherit devilish powers straight from Imu. That will explain the reason behind the Five Elders’ demonic transformations. Powers Obtained Through the Devil Contract with Imu

Ever since the Five Elders and the Holy Knights’ introduction, we have seen many demonic powers and abilities in One Piece. So, here are all the powers (we know so far) granted by Imu to her servants who entered a contract with them:

  • Abyss Mark: Lets one travel between locations via the dark magic circle.
  • Telepathy: The Five Elders communicated with each other telepathically in the Egghead arc.
  • Regeneration: Regenerate their injured body parts.
  • Improved Strength: The Holy Knights’ strength multiplies once they accept a covenant.
  • Immortality: The Five Elders have been existing for centuries, blessed with the gift of immortality.
  • Submission of Will: In return for Immortality and enhanced strength, the knights will obey and follow Imu’s orders without any disagreement.
  • Demonic Powers: Each of the Five Elders acquired a yokai-based demonic power.
  • Becoming a Vessel: Both St. Saturn and Gunko have become a vessel for Imu to take control of.

All the Characters Who Have the Abyss Mark in One Piece

We have seen a handful of individuals who can access Imu’s powers with the Abyss Mark. Although Oda hasn’t yet disclosed the World Government officials and their respective Abyss contracts in the story, we have listed them below based on what we have seen so far:

World Government officialsTheir Potential Covenant Type
St. Marcus MarsTh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Topman WarcuryTh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Ethanbaron V. NusjuroTh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Shepherd Ju PeterTh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Figarland GarlingTh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Manmayer GunkoThe Abyssal Covenant
St. Figarland Shamrock The Depths Covenant
St. Shepherd SommersThe Depths Covenant
St. Rimoshifu KillinghamThe Depths Covenant
St. Satchels MaffeyThe Depths Covenant
Four Unnamed God’s KnightsThe Depths Covenant
St. Saturn (Deceased)The Abyssal Covenant
King Harald (Deceased)The Depths Covenant
St. Figarland Shanks (Estranged)The Shallows Covenant
